Early Life
Marcia Wallace was born in Creston, Iowa, though details about her birthdate are not available. She attended Parsons College and graduated with degrees in English and Theater. Her passion for acting led her to move to New York City after graduation, where she pursued a full-time career in the entertainment industry.
Career
Wallace’s career began to flourish during her time in New York City, where she gained recognition through her performances in improv shows in Greenwich Village. In addition, she co-founded a group called The Fourth Wall. Her talents soon caught the attention of casting directors, and she started working Off-Broadway.
Later on, Marcia Wallace transitioned to television and made appearances on popular shows such as “The Merv Griffin Show,” “Bewitched,” “The Brady Bunch,” “The Bob Newhart Show,” “Magnum, P.I.,” “Murder, She Wrote,” “Teen Witch,” “A Different World,” “Full House,” “Murphy Brown,” “That’s My Bush,” “7th Heaven,” and “The Young and the Restless.”
One of Marcia Wallace’s most notable roles was providing the voice of Edna Krabapple on the long-running animated series “The Simpsons” from 1990 until her passing in October 2013. Her exceptional voice acting skills added depth and humor to the beloved character.
